    Hi, I bought this display and configured it in platformio as esp32-s3-devkitc-1-n16r8v, but I really dont know if it's correct. Someone say there is 2M PSRAM, someone else 8M. Can you suggest a right platformio config?

    • @ThatProject
      @ThatProject  8 місяців тому

      n16r8 means it has 16MB Flash and 8MB PSRAM. Hence, set it to 8MB PSRAM. It’ll be working.

      @@rhianjustin I shared this with someone else and this is his solution.
      \esp-idf\components\driver\include\driver\sdspi_host.h for WT32-SC01+
      form
      #define SDSPI_SLOT_CONFIG_DEFAULT() {\
      .gpio_cs = GPIO_NUM_13, \
      .gpio_cd = SDSPI_SLOT_NO_CD, \
      .gpio_wp = SDSPI_SLOT_NO_WP, \
      .gpio_int = GPIO_NUM_NC, \
      .gpio_miso = GPIO_NUM_2, \
      .gpio_mosi = GPIO_NUM_15, \
      .gpio_sck = GPIO_NUM_14, \
      .dma_channel = 1, \
      to this
      #define SDSPI_SLOT_CONFIG_DEFAULT() {\
      .gpio_cs = GPIO_NUM_41, \
      .gpio_cd = SDSPI_SLOT_NO_CD, \
      .gpio_wp = SDSPI_SLOT_NO_WP, \
      .gpio_int = GPIO_NUM_NC, \
      .gpio_miso = GPIO_NUM_38, \
      .gpio_mosi = GPIO_NUM_40 \
      .gpio_sck = GPIO_NUM_39, \
      .dma_channel = 1, \
      and now work the SD card with the SD.h and so on :-)
